I just noticed this thread, can't watch video right now, but I loved the wrestling games back then. Most were mentioned. The arcade version of Tag Team Wrestling was great... I looked for that any time we hit a boardwalk over the summers. I didn't like the NES version (or was it the C64?) so much, but still played. Loved the original NES Pro Wrestling. Tecmo's was very good also. C64 (Epyx) Championship Wrestling kept me busy a long time, loved it back then.. as well as Bop/Rock n Wrestle. The WWF arcade games were great. Great! The Main Event was huge amongst our group for a time... even set up a big tag team match, with week-long hype and drama. I was on the winning side of that match! Mat Mania is probably #1, maybe #2... that one was excellent. Mania Challenge, not as much, but I never tired of Mat Mania. -
